Converteer moeiteloos Microsoft Outlook-e-mails naar Excel-spreadsheets met GroupDocs.Conversion voor .NET
Invoering
Wilt u het proces van het extraheren van gegevens uit uw Microsoft Outlook-e-mails automatiseren? Het converteren van MSG-bestanden naar een eenvoudig te analyseren formaat zoals XLS kan tijd besparen en uw workflow stroomlijnen. Deze tutorial begeleidt u bij het gebruik van GroupDocs.Conversion voor .NET om e-mailberichten (.msg) te converteren naar Excel-spreadsheets (.xls). Na afloop heeft u een gedegen inzicht in hoe u dit proces efficiënt kunt automatiseren.
Wat je leert:
- GroupDocs.Conversion voor .NET in uw project instellen
- Een stapsgewijze handleiding voor het converteren van MSG-bestanden naar XLS-formaat
- Praktische toepassingen en integratiemogelijkheden
- Tips voor het optimaliseren van prestaties en het oplossen van veelvoorkomende problemen
Laten we eerst de vereisten doornemen, zodat u de cursus soepel kunt volgen.
Vereisten
Voordat we beginnen, zorg ervoor dat u het volgende heeft:
Vereiste bibliotheken en afhankelijkheden
- GroupDocs.Conversion voor .NET: Versie 25.3.0 of later.
- Microsoft Visual StudioElke recente versie (2017/2019/2022).
Vereisten voor omgevingsinstellingen
- Basiskennis van C#-programmering.
- Toegang tot een ontwikkelomgeving waarin u NuGet-pakketten kunt installeren.
Zodra aan deze vereisten is voldaan, kunnen we doorgaan met het instellen van GroupDocs.Conversion voor .NET.
GroupDocs.Conversion instellen voor .NET
Om aan de slag te gaan met GroupDocs.Conversion, moet je het als afhankelijkheid aan je project toevoegen. Zo doe je dat:
Installeren via NuGet Package Manager Console
Install-Package GroupDocs.Conversion -Version 25.3.0
Installeren met behulp van .NET CLI
dotnet add package GroupDocs.Conversion --version 25.3.0
Stappen voor het verkrijgen van een licentie
GroupDocs biedt verschillende licentieopties:
- Gratis proefperiode: Download een proefversie om de basisfunctionaliteiten te ontdekken.
- Tijdelijke licentie: Verkrijg deze optie voor uitgebreide toegang zonder functiebeperkingen.
- Aankoop: Voor volledige toegang kunt u overwegen een licentie aan te schaffen.
Na de installatie initialiseert u de bibliotheek met een eenvoudige C#-code:
using GroupDocs.Conversion;
Met deze regel bent u ervan verzekerd dat u alle conversiefuncties van de bibliotheek kunt gebruiken.
Implementatiegids
Laten we ons nu concentreren op het converteren van een MSG-bestand naar XLS met behulp van GroupDocs.Conversion. Hier is hoe het stap voor stap gaat.
Overzicht van MSG naar XLS-conversie
Het doel is om e-mailinhoud die is opgeslagen in .msg-bestanden om te zetten naar gestructureerde Excel-spreadsheets (.xls). Dit proces vereenvoudigt het extraheren en analyseren van gegevens uit e-mails.
Stap 1: Uw bestandspaden voorbereiden
Definieer eerst de mappen voor uw bron- en uitvoerbestanden:
string sourceFilePath = Path.Combine("YOUR_DOCUMENT_DIRECTORY", "sample.msg");
string outputFolder = Path.Combine("YOUR_OUTPUT_DIRECTORY");
string outputFile = Path.Combine(outputFolder, "msg-converted-to.xls");
Hier vervangen "YOUR_DOCUMENT_DIRECTORY"
met het pad dat uw .msg-bestand bevat en "YOUR_OUTPUT_DIRECTORY"
waar u het geconverteerde .xls-bestand wilt opslaan.
Stap 2: Het MSG-bestand laden en converteren
using (var converter = new Converter(sourceFilePath))
{
var options = new SpreadsheetConvertOptions { Format = SpreadsheetFileType.Xls };
converter.Convert(outputFile, options);
}
Uitleg:
- Converterklasse: Laadt uw .msg-bestand.
- SpreadsheetConvertopties: Hiermee configureert u de conversie naar XLS-formaat.
Tips voor probleemoplossing
Als u problemen ondervindt:
- Zorg ervoor dat paden correct zijn gedefinieerd en toegankelijk zijn.
- Controleer of het GroupDocs.Conversion-pakket correct is geïnstalleerd.
Praktische toepassingen
Het converteren van MSG-bestanden naar XLS kan in verschillende scenario’s nuttig zijn:
- Gegevensanalyse: Exporteer e-mailgegevens voor analyse met Excel-hulpmiddelen.
- Archivering:Bewaar belangrijke communicatie in een gestructureerde vorm.
- Rapportage: Genereer rapporten op basis van e-mailinhoud voor naleving of zakelijke inzichten.
- Integratie: Gebruik geconverteerde gegevens binnen CRM-systemen of andere .NET-toepassingen.
Prestatieoverwegingen
Om optimale prestaties te garanderen bij het converteren van bestanden:
- Minimaliseer het geheugengebruik door bestanden sequentieel te verwerken als u met grote datasets werkt.
- Werk GroupDocs.Conversion regelmatig bij om te profiteren van de nieuwste optimalisaties en bugfixes.
- Gooi objecten op de juiste manier weg om bronnen vrij te maken.
Conclusie
Je hebt nu geleerd hoe je MSG-bestanden naar XLS-formaat kunt converteren met GroupDocs.Conversion voor .NET. Deze krachtige tool kan je productiviteit aanzienlijk verhogen door de extractie van e-mailgegevens te automatiseren. Overweeg om deze oplossing verder te integreren met andere systemen of te experimenteren met andere conversieformaten die GroupDocs aanbiedt.
Volgende stappen: Probeer deze functie te implementeren in een echt project en ontdek het volledige potentieel van GroupDocs.Conversion!
FAQ-sectie
Wat is GroupDocs.Conversion voor .NET?
- Een bibliotheek waarmee u bestandsformaten kunt converteren, bijvoorbeeld van MSG naar XLS.
Kan ik meerdere bestanden tegelijk converteren?
- Ja, met een aantal aanpassingen om batches in uw code te verwerken.
Is er een gratis versie beschikbaar?
- U kunt de proefversie downloaden en testen voor een eerste gebruik.
Hoe los ik conversiefouten op?
- Controleer bestandspaden, zorg dat afhankelijkheden correct zijn geïnstalleerd en raadpleeg foutlogboeken voor meer informatie.
Kan ik converteren naar andere formaten dan XLS?
- Absoluut! GroupDocs ondersteunt een breed scala aan documentformaten.
Bronnen
Begin vandaag nog met converteren en profiteer van nieuwe mogelijkheden voor efficiënter beheer van uw e-mailgegevens!